Output 827673993ac5a858a4f8f2acfd30d4c72690840048b7377c87c5ae28cc0af240:0

value
577438
script pubkey
OP_0 OP_PUSHBYTES_20 d042f00f1a68e0333806b8b9916c393a8e35a6aa
address
bc1q6pp0qrc6drsrxwqxhzuezmpe828rtf42rj35ky
transaction
827673993ac5a858a4f8f2acfd30d4c72690840048b7377c87c5ae28cc0af240
spent
true